New submission from Serhiy Storchaka <storchaka+cpyt...@gmail.com>: All changes to the magic number in Lib/importlib/_bootstrap_external.py are attributed with 3.7a0. But they were made at different stages.
There is also inconsistency in specifying Python version for older changes. Some authors specify the first Python version after bumping the magic number (i.e. the version that was released with this magic number). Others specify the Python version after which the bumping was made. I think the former is correct. The proposed PR fixes Python versions and adds issue numbers if known.
